Lemon & parsley Pan-fried Gurnard Fillets

Lemon & parsley Pan-fried Gurnard Fillets

 Serves: 4      Prep Time: 5mins      Cook Time: 10 mins 

 

INGREDIENTS

 

  • 4 pieces gurnard fillets
  • approx 50g flour for dusting
  • salt and pepper
  • 100g butter
  • small handful of parsley
  • 1 lemon

HOW TO MAKE IT

  1. Place the flour in a bowl. Season the fillets first and coat both sides in flour. Shake off any excess flour and set aside.

  2. Melt 80g of the butter in the frying pan and add the fillets to be pan.

  3. Fry the gurnard fillets for 3-4 mins using a spoon to constantly baste in butter

  4. Turn the fillets over and cook for a further 1-2 mins while continuing to baste with butter. The fish should turn a golden color on each side.

  5. Remove the fish from the pan and set aside on your serving plates.

  6. Add the remaining 20g of butter to the pan until it produces a lovely nutty smell, then add the chopped parsley and a good squeeze of lemon cooking for a minute. 

  7. Turn off the heat and spoon this mixture over the fillets. Enjoy it with your choice of vegetables.
